Transaction 3243e6e4ef0d72f70b950ee763b44de40c8534d6b75bcd4535266a7eeddd8994

1 Input
2 Outputs
  • 3243e6e4ef0d72f70b950ee763b44de40c8534d6b75bcd4535266a7eeddd8994:0
  • value  40949
    address  12bHz5fY9PDERzTr5Yk8kv95fKBJSb7LbN
  • 3243e6e4ef0d72f70b950ee763b44de40c8534d6b75bcd4535266a7eeddd8994:1
  • value  132291
    address  33D5H3ucGvUMPphFgCjtDPwfUEiPTG6Vby